Hi all here's an update on this, I think the kit exhaust is toooo shiney,

Sooo, mask up the exhaust straps

Spray with hairspray then sprinkle talcum powder on it

Respray with hairspray and then sprinkle on some salt

I think it looks much more realistic now

Hi all well the world record version had two seats so the co driver could use the pump to increase the fuel/air mix.
Here is my first attempt at the extra seat.



As you can plainly see it's rubbish, this was made with das modelling clay and I tried a few times with this (including trying to make a mould of the original but none were any good so I tried a different approach, i heated some 2 mil plastic and wrapped it round the seat, let that cool then heated some more and pushed inside that which (although not an exact copy gave me the shape of the seat) I then sanded and cut the sides to suit.
So here is the next version


And here they are installed, just a few more bits to do now.

Anyway for those that didn't follow the build this is not the red version in the museum it's the Ernest Eldridge world record run version, the tail had to be raised and the skirt lowered also an extra seat for the co-driver had to be added all else is out of the box, I've seen some amazing builds of this kit where an amazing amount of detail has been added, I'm no where near as patient as that or talented so here is my version of this amazing kit.
